Gurha Population - Chittaurgarh, Rajasthan
Gurha is a medium size village located in Kapasan Tehsil of Chittaurgarh district, Rajasthan with total 152 families residing. The Gurha village has population of 653 of which 318 are males while 335 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Gurha village population of children with age 0-6 is 85 which makes up 13.02 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Gurha village is 1053 which is higher than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Gurha as per census is 977, higher than Rajasthan average of 888.
Gurha village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Gurha village was 43.66 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Gurha Male literacy stands at 63.64 % while female literacy rate was 24.91 %.

Gurha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 152 | - | - |
Population | 653 | 318 | 335 |
Child (0-6) | 85 | 43 | 42 |
Schedule Caste | 137 | 75 | 62 |
Schedule Tribe | 95 | 45 | 50 |
Literacy | 43.66 % | 63.64 % | 24.91 % |
Total Workers | 427 | 216 | 211 |
Main Worker | 191 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 236 | 25 | 211 |
